Amber Chambers Meyerl currently works at The Quell Foundation, Inc., as Executive Director from 2023.
Ms. Meyerl received her graduate degree from Duquesne University of The Holy Spirit.

![]() The Quell Foundation, Inc. Miscellaneous Commercial ServicesCommercial Services The Quell Foundation, Inc. is a non-profit organization based in an undisclosed location. The foundation aims to reduce the number of suicides, overdoses, and incarcerations of people living with mental illness. The American company encourages people to share their stories, increase access to mental health services, and support first responders in recognizing mental health warning signs. The foundation promotes open and judgment-free dialogue to normalize conversations around mental health. The private company also awards scholarships for a brighter future in the mental health field, increase access to services for better care and treatment, and encourage the sharing of personal stories to inspire hope.
